  • cmder

    Lovely console emulator package for Windows

  • [Windows only]

    I recently discovered Cmder:

    https://cmder.app/

    It's a portable console emulator and gives you the ability to "place your own executable files into the bin folder to be injected into your PATH" when it's run.
